"Gene Kan was found in his Belmont home on July 2, 2002 with a bullet hole through the head. The San Mateo County Coroner fixed the date of death at June 29 and concluded that Kan had taken his own life. Presumably the suicide was triggered by one of Kan's longstanding bouts with depression for which he had been seeking treatment."

Gene Kan and others started the original Gnutella portal, gnutella.wego.com, which was essential for helping people hook up to the network. Gene was also a founder of InfraSearch.com, an attempt to use decentralized technology for querying databases. InfraSearch was endorsed by Mosaic/Netscape co-creator Marc Andreessen. InfraSearch later became a part of Sun's JXTA project.
